Located at approximately 151 metres above sea level, the vineyard lies on deep, fertile brown clay soil rich in gravel, capable of retaining moisture and supporting steady ripening even during dry periods. The result is an elegant interpretation of classic Valpolicella, defined by freshness, aromatic precision and finesse.
After gentle crushing, fermentation is carried out with dry ice to preserve and enhance the grapes’ distinctive spicy aromas. The wine matures for a total of 36 months in the cellar, including ten months in 25-hectolitre Stockinger oak casks. Aromas of raspberry, cherry and blackcurrant are complemented by violet, lavender, sage, thyme, tea leaves and white pepper. The palate is focused and energetic, combining lively freshness, measured tannins and a refined spicy character with a precise, persistent finish.
The name 44 Verticale refers to the vineyard plot where the varieties used in the wine come together, while “Verticale” describes its aromatic purity and vibrant progression across the palate. The number 44 also coincides with the year of birth of Alfredo Buglioni, who founded the winery together with his son Mariano. A remarkably versatile food wine, it pairs with white meats, game birds, cod, salmon, spicy fish soups, mushroom or truffle risotto and pasta. It also works beautifully with umami-rich Asian cuisine and aromatic or mildly spicy dishes. Serve at approximately 14 °C.
